Calibrating for Readback Accuracy

Calibrating for Readback Accuracy
The factory calibrates the offset and range of the output voltage and current monitor
circuits to within 1% for the default 0-10 Vdc scales. You may need to recalibrate
when you select the 0-5 Vdc scale or when you switch back to the 0-10 Vdc scale
after previously calibrating for 0-5 Vdc operation.
See Section for instructions to remove the cover and any option card. Follow all
procedure steps in the sequence given.
